Der deutsche Goldrausch

Der deutsche Goldrausch

Dirk Laabs
4.4/5 ( ratings)
Dirk Laabs, a German journalist and documentary film maker, describes the five-year operation of the "Treuhandanstalt", the agency that privatized the East German enterprises after the end of GDR in 1990. Organized as a peculiar state agency, hampered by a lack of ressources and pressed by various interests, the enormous task of restructuring state-owned companies with more than 4 million employees often resembled a cross between 'wild west' and white-collar crime novels.
